As the spring high school sports season 2025 approaches the end, many teams celebrate their achievements as region champions. Several teams from the Savannah area are sharing their region title victories with pride on social media.
Islands High School boys' soccer has clinched the Region 3-AAA championship with an 11-3 overall record and a perfect 9-0 region slate. The Sharks' impressive win percentage of .786 into the postseason brings considerable momentum.
On the girls' side, the Calvary Day Lady Cavaliers soccer team finished their regular season undefeated at 8-0. With a spotless region record, the Lady Cavaliers also claimed the 3A Region 3 title and look poised for a deep playoff run.
Richmond Hill girls lacrosse is also celebrating, finishing atop the GHSA 2A Area 4 with a perfect 4-0 region mark. Despite a 8-6 overall record, the Wildcats are heating up with three straight wins at the right time.
And on the courts, Benedictine's boys tennis team emerged as the GHSA Region 1-AAAA Tournament Champions. The Cadets are making noise again with a number one seed going into the GHSA playoffs with a shot at another deep postseason run.
